Greetings...

While playing in the snow I noticed I can't seem to get my rear diff to lock (simply by stepping on the foot pedal, I assume...). I checked the Parts book (Thanks again Len!) and externally all the parts are there. Has anyone else had this problem? Will a little WD 40 or PB Blaster clear it up, or will I most likely need to take the spring assembly apart? Just wondering if anyone else has experienced this before I drag the tools to the tractor (it's in the woods right now, snowed in at the piece of property I'm working on. It is very possible that it froze where it goes through the housing. Use some loosener & tap lightly with a hammer every once in a while till it loosens
